Freddie Mac Reports Steady Growth in Q1 2025 Earnings

Freddie Mac ( (FMCC) ) has released its Q1 earnings. Here is a breakdown of the information Freddie Mac presented to its investors.

Freddie Mac, a leading player in the U.S. housing finance sector, is dedicated to promoting liquidity, stability, and affordability in the housing market through its extensive mortgage and rental financing services. In the first quarter of 2025, Freddie Mac reported a net income of $2.8 billion, marking a 1% increase from the previous year, with net revenues reaching $5.9 billion, driven by higher net interest income despite a decline in non-interest income. The company financed 224,000 mortgages and 89,000 rental units, with a significant portion supporting low- to moderate-income families and first-time homebuyers. The company’s mortgage portfolio grew to $3.6 trillion, with a serious delinquency rate remaining stable at 0.59%. Freddie Mac’s strategic focus on credit enhancements saw 62% of its mortgage portfolio covered, while its multifamily segment faced challenges with a 35% decline in net income year-over-year. Looking ahead, Freddie Mac remains committed to its mission of making homeownership and rental opportunities more accessible, while working with regulatory bodies to streamline operations and enhance cost efficiencies.
